Maclintok wrote:

Speaking mostly out of my arse, but don't console fighting game communities stay more vibrant and for longer than those for PC (for now)?

Generally an FGC flourishes when the game is good and there's a low point of entry (see: Smash). It's easier to do that on a console because you only need TV/Console/Game and in-person events are going to do it as cheaply as possible. I am a PC gamer and sure, it's nice that I can use any stick on this thing but if I'm going to do something in person? I can toss stick/ps4 into a bag and go somewhere.

That said, the reddit SF FGC is actually pretty big and generally extremely helpful. I think now that online play can be good (and it's... fine most of the time), we'll see PC-centric communities pop up and thrive.

What I want, and I think we're moving in this direction, is cross-platform play for everything. I think that's the way forward for the genre and it's how it can stay relevant long-term. Fighting games thrive like other games, with a community. Communities only grow when the content is compelling and it's easy to actually play the game. Cross-platform would do that.

My soul burned such that I picked it up. It plays nice, the characters you actually care about are back, there are two story modes (presented visual novel style, so mileage could vary), I wouldn't say the extensive lore gets "fleshed out" exactly, but it's put to use, and the character creator is as fun as ever.

However, there are still some critical omissions in the roster--Yun-seong, Hilde, Setsuka, and personally I preferred Cassandra to Sophitia. DLC will add some of them...but the existence of this sort of DLC is another issue. And the creator needs more gear and is missing some classics, boots especially. That's more DLC...
